WebCool roofs reflect more sunlight and absorb less heat than traditional roofs. Traditional dark-colored roofing materials strongly absorb heat from sunlight, making them warm in the sun and heating the building. On the other hand, cool roofs stay cooler in the sun and transmit less heat into the building. WebDec 25, 2024 · Another way the solar panels protect your roof is by cooling it down.
